In a rapidly evolving world, the landscape of legal services is changing. One of the major shifts in the industry is the rise of alternative legal service providers (ALSPs), which are on a mission to streamline legal work and deliver cost-effectiveness to clients. From virtual legal teams to legal process outsourcing and legal tech companies, these innovative entities are transforming the way legal services are delivered.
Redefining Legal Service Delivery
Alternative legal services are helping to redefine how legal services are delivered, moving away from the traditional law firm model. They leverage innovative technologies, flexible work models, and streamlined processes to provide more efficient and cost-effective legal solutions.
Many of these ALSPs focus on routine, high-volume tasks such as document review, contract management, and regulatory compliance. This allows in-house legal teams and traditional law firms to concentrate on complex, high-value tasks.
Reduced Costs and Increased Efficiency
Cost reduction is one of the significant benefits of using alternative legal services.
By using efficient work models and advanced technologies, ALSPs can perform routine legal tasks at a fraction of the cost traditional law firms charge. This allows businesses to manage their legal budgets more effectively, freeing up resources for other crucial areas.
Enhanced Technological Capabilities
Alternative legal service providers are often at the cutting edge of legal technology. They harness the power of technologies like automation, artificial intelligence, and cloud computing to streamline legal processes and improve service delivery. This tech-savvy approach allows for faster turnaround times, greater accuracy, and improved data security.
Flexible and Scalable Services
One of the major attractions of alternative legal service providers is their scalability and flexibility. Whether a business needs support for a one-off project or ongoing legal assistance, ALSPs can tailor their services to meet these varying needs. This agility makes them an attractive choice for businesses of all sizes, from startups to multinational corporations.
Access to Global Legal Talent
With a remote-first approach, ALSPs give businesses access to a global pool of legal talent. These providers often have a network of legal professionals across different jurisdictions, allowing them to offer a broader range of services and insights. This global reach can be particularly beneficial for businesses operating in multiple regions, requiring expertise in different legal systems.
While alternative legal services are transforming the legal industry, they are not intended to replace traditional law firms or in-house legal teams.
Instead, they offer a complementary solution, filling the gaps in the traditional model and helping legal professionals focus on what they do best. At the same time, they offer businesses more choice and flexibility in how they access and use legal services.
Their rise is a clear indication of the changing dynamics in the legal industry, shifting towards more innovative, cost-effective, and client-focused service delivery.
